stancel.nginx_site_removal

nginxサイト削除

NginXウェブサーバー上の1つまたは複数の新しい仮想ホストを削除するAnsibleロールです。

要件

このロールを実行するサーバーにNginXがすでにセットアップされ、動作している必要があります。

ロール変数

ウェブサーバー上に設定してホストするサイト

    nginx_site_removal_sites_to_remove:
      - {
          url: 'mysite.com',
          name: 'mysite'
        }

(デフォルト)ウェブサーバーのドキュメントルート。デフォルト値は "/var/www" です。

    nginx_site_removal_web_home: "/var/www"

依存関係

なし

使用例

ユーザーのためにロールの使い方の例(例えば、変数をパラメーターとして渡す方法)を示すと便利です:

- hosts: your_webserver
  vars_files:
    - vars/main.yml
  roles:
    - stancel.nginx_site_removal 

または、プレイブック内で変数を直接渡すこともできます。

- hosts: your_webserver 
  vars:
    nginx_site_removal_sites_to_remove:
      - {
          url: 'mysite.com',
          name: 'mysite'
        }
  roles:
    - stancel.nginx_site_removal

ライセンス

GPLv3

著者情報

Brad Stance

プロジェクトについて

Removes up one or more virtual hosts on an NginX webserver

インストール
ansible-galaxy install stancel.nginx_site_removal
ライセンス
Unknown
ダウンロード
102
所有者